Performance That Impresses 

Under the hood, the BMW X1 available in India comes with a choice of both petrol and diesel engine options. Both powertrains are paired with a 7-speed Steptronic automatic transmission for smooth shifts and fuel efficiency. 

Engine Options: 

  • 1.5L turbo petrol: 136 hp, 230 Nm 
  • 2.0L diesel engine: 150 hp, 360 Nm 

The X1 acc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in just under 9 seconds, which is commendable for its segment. The suspension setup strikes a balance between comfort and dynamic handling, staying true to BMW’s driver-focused philosophy. 

BMW X1 Mileage and Fuel Efficiency 

Fuel economy is crucial for Indian buyers, and the X1 delivers commendable figures: 

  • Petrol: 16.3 km/l (ARAI-certified) 
  • Diesel: 20.4 km/l (ARAI-certified) 

In real-world driving, expect about 13–14 km/l in the city and up to 18 km/l on the highway with the diesel variant.

BMW X1 Price in India 

As of 2025, the BMW X1 price in India starts from ₹49.50 lakh and goes up to ₹52.50 lakh, depending on the variant and powertrain. 

Variants Available: 

  • X1 sDrive18i xLine (Petrol) 
  • X1 sDrive18d M Sport (Diesel)

BMW X1 vs Rivals: 

The BMW X1 competes with: 

  • Audi Q3 
  • Mercedes-Benz GLA 
  • Volvo XC40 

Compared to rivals, the X1 offers more boot space, better fuel economy (especially diesel), and sharper driving dynamics. However, Audi’s Q3 may feel more refined in cabin quality, while the GLA excels in ride comfort.
